What to Ask Barber Schools

Fort Pierce Florida senior customer receiving trim from barberFollowing is a series of questions that you should research for any barber college you are contemplating. As we have previously discussed, the location of the school relative to your Fort Pierce FL residence, in addition to the price of tuition, will most likely be your first qualifiers. Whether you would like to pursue a certificate, diploma or a degree will probably be next on your list. But once you have narrowed your school options based on those initial qualifications, there are even more factors that you should research and consider before enrolling in a barber school. Below we have compiled some of those supplemental questions that you should ask every school before making a final selection.

Is the Barber School Accredited? It's necessary to make sure that the barber college you enroll in is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ards guaranteeing a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for acquiring student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not available for non- accredited schools. It's also a criteria for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, a number of Fort Pierce FL businesses will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Does the School have an Excellent Reputation?  Every barber school that you are seriously evaluating should have a good to outstanding reputation within the field. Being accredited is a good starting point. Next, ask the schools for testimonials from their network of businesses where they have placed their students. Verify that the schools have high job placement rates, showing that their students are highly sought after. Visit rating services for reviews in addition to the school's accrediting agencies. If you have any contacts with Fort Pierce FL barber shop owners or managers, or someone working in the field, ask them if they are familiar with the schools you are looking at. They might even be able to propose others that you had not looked into. And last, check with the Florida school licensing authority to see if there have been any grievances submitted or if the schools are in total compliance.

What’s the School’s Focus?  A number of beauty schools offer programs that are comprehensive in nature, focusing on all areas of cosmetology. Others are more focused, providing training in a specific specialty, for example barbering. Schools that offer degree programs frequently broaden into a management and marketing curriculum. So it's imperative that you decide on a school that focuses on your area of interest. Since your goal is to be trained as a barber, make sure that the school you enroll in is accredited and well regarded for that program. If your dream is to launch a barber shop in Fort Pierce FL, then you need to enroll in a degree program that will teach you how to be an owner/operator. Choosing a highly regarded school with a poor program in barbering will not provide the training you require.

Is Enough Live Training Provided?  Studying and perfecting barbering skills and techniques requires lots of practice on people. Find out how much live, hands-on training is furnished in the barber lessons you will be attending. A number of schools have shops on site that make it possible for students to practice their growing talents on real people. If a Fort Pierce FL barber college offers limited or no scheduled live training, but rather relies predominantly on using mannequins, it may not be the most effective alternative for acquiring your skills. So look for other schools that furnish this kind of training.

Does the School Provide Job Assistance?  Once a student graduates from a barber school, it's important that he or she gets help in securing that initial job. Job placement programs are an important part of that process. Schools that furnish aid develop relationships with local employers that are seeking skilled graduates available for hiring. Verify that the schools you are contemplating have job placement programs and find out which Fort Pierce FL area shops and establishments they refer students to. Additionally, ask what their job placement rates are. Higher rates not only confirm that they have broad networks of employers, but that their programs are highly respected as well.

Is Financial Aid Available?  Many barber schools offer financ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Check if the schools you are looking at have a financial aid department. Talk to a counselor and learn what student loans or grants you might get approved for. If the school is a member of the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ships accessible to students too. If a school meets each of your other qualifications with the exception of expense, do not drop it as an alternative before you determine what financial assistance may be provided in Fort Pierce FL.
